Power Cleans
Power cleans are a fundamental Olympic lift that significantly enhances the explosive power and speed of rugby athletes. This movement involves pulling the bar from the ground to your shoulders in one swift, powerful motion, which mimics the explosive actions needed in rugby.
Mastering the power clean helps develop muscles in the legs, hips, back, and shoulders, creating a solid foundation for functional strength on the field. It promotes coordination and timing, crucial for rapid gameplay and sudden accelerations.
To perform a power clean safely and effectively, proper technique is vital. Athletes should focus on maintaining a balanced stance, gripping the bar firmly, and executing the pull and catch phases with controlled precision. This minimizes injury risks and maximizes performance gains.
Incorporating power cleans into rugby fitness programs can revolutionize your training. This lift boosts overall power, enhances athletic explosiveness, and prepares players to perform at their peak during intense match situations.

Split Jerks
The split jerk is a dynamic Olympic lift that enhances shoulder strength, stability, and explosive power, making it highly beneficial for rugby athletes. It involves quickly driving the bar overhead while splitting the legs into a lunge position, then stabilizing before recovery.
Mastering the split jerk requires proper technique and timing. It starts with a strong dip and drive phase, propelling the bar upward with controlled power. The split position involves placing one foot forward and the other back, maintaining balance and alignment for maximum stability.
To perform the split jerk effectively, athletes must emphasize proper stance and grip. Keeping the feet in a stable split stance allows for better control under heavy loads. Ensuring the elbows are locked and the wrists are firm contributes to secure bar support and safe overhead positioning.
Consistent practice with focus on technique helps prevent common errors like uneven splitting, poor balance, or inadequate lockout. Incorporating the split jerk into rugby fitness programs boosts overall power and speed, translating well into explosive movements on the field.

Proper Stance and Grip
A proper stance and grip are foundational to executing Olympic lifts safely and effectively for rugby athletes. Starting with a shoulder-width stance ensures stability and balance, which are crucial during explosive movements. Your feet should be firmly planted, with toes slightly pointing outward to allow natural hip kinematics.
Your grip on the bar must be firm yet comfortable, typically slightly wider than shoulder-width. A secure grip improves control during the lift’s pull and catch phases, reducing the risk of slipping or mishaps. For power cleans and snatches, placing the hands evenly on the bar helps maintain symmetry and proper bar path.
A proper stance and grip also influence your posture and spine alignment throughout the lift. Keeping your chest up and back straight helps distribute the load correctly and enhances power transfer. Remember, developing consistency in stance and grip sets a strong foundation for mastering Olympic lifts tailored for rugby performance.

Best Training Frequencies and Volumes
Optimal training frequency for Olympic lifts for rugby athletes typically involves 2 to 3 sessions per week. This allows enough recovery time while maintaining consistent technique practice and strength development. Balancing intensity and rest is key to making steady progress.
Training volume should generally include 3 to 5 sets of 3 to 8 repetitions per session. This range promotes strength gains and explosive power without risking overtraining or technique deterioration. As athletes improve, gradually increasing weight and reducing repetitions ensures continuous progression.
Monitoring individual recovery and performance is vital. Adjustments might be necessary based on an athlete’s fatigue levels or overall training load. Incorporating proper deload weeks every 4 to 6 weeks can prevent burnout and sustain long-term progress. This structured approach helps rugby players enhance power efficiently and safely through Olympic lifts for rugby athletes.
Progression and Load Management
When training rugby athletes with Olympic lifts, managing progression and load is vital for optimal results and safety. Gradually increasing intensity helps build strength, explosiveness, and confidence while reducing injury risk. A smart approach ensures continuous improvement without overtraining or setbacks.
To effectively manage load, consider these key practices:
- Start with a manageable weight, focusing on technique mastery.
- Progress by increasing the load in small, controlled increments—typically 2.5% to 5%.
- Adjust training volume based on athlete response, aiming for 2-3 sessions per week for Olympic lifts.
- Incorporate regular deload periods to facilitate recovery and adaptation.
Monitoring athlete feedback and performance indicators is critical for tailoring progression. Use these insights to avoid pushing too hard, which can compromise form and increase injury risk. Remember, steady, mindful load progression unlocks peak performance in rugby through safe, effective Olympic lift training.
